高主频ecs服务器怎么迁移?ecs服务器迁移数据丢失怎么办

高主频ECS服务器迁移的核心在于采用“停机快照+镜像创建”或“在线热迁移”方案,前者数据一致性最高且操作最稳妥,后者对业务连续性要求极高但技术门槛较大。

在云计算领域,高主频实例通常用于处理高频交易、实时计算或大型游戏服务器等对CPU算力极度敏感的场景,这类业务一旦中断,损失往往是分钟级甚至秒级的,迁移不仅仅是数据的搬运,更是一场关于稳定性、兼容性和最小化停机时间的精密操作,业内专家指出,正确的迁移策略能将业务中断时间控制在分钟以内,而错误的操作则可能导致数小时甚至数天的数据灾难。

高主频ECS服务器迁移前的环境评估与准备

在动手之前,必须对当前环境进行彻底“体检”,高主频实例往往伴随着特殊的硬件特性,如特定的CPU架构或增强的网络性能,这些特性直接影响迁移后的表现。

确认实例规格与架构兼容性

不同云厂商的高主频实例底层架构可能存在差异,从Intel Xeon迁移到AMD EPYC,或者跨代际迁移,都需要确认目标实例是否支持源实例的CPU特性。

  • 架构一致性检查:确认源实例和目标实例的CPU指令集是否兼容,如果目标实例不支持源实例的某些高级指令集(如AVX-512),迁移后应用可能会崩溃或性能下降。
  • 操作系统版本匹配:确保目标实例的操作系统版本不低于源实例,以避免驱动或内核模块不兼容。
  • 磁盘类型对比:高主频实例通常搭配高效云盘或SSD云盘,迁移时需确认目标区域的磁盘类型是否可用,以及IOPS性能是否满足原业务需求。

数据备份与完整性校验

备份是迁移的最后一道防线,也是最重要的一道防线,不要依赖云厂商的默认快照策略,必须手动创建全量快照。

  • 系统盘快照:创建包含操作系统、应用配置和关键数据的系统盘快照。
  • 高主频ecs服务器怎么迁移?ecs服务器迁移数据丢失怎么办

  • 数据盘快照:如果有独立的数据盘,务必单独创建快照,确保数据完整性。
  • 校验机制:在创建快照后,通过云控制台查看快照状态,确保状态为“已完成”且无错误提示,据工信部相关数据安全指南建议,关键业务数据应至少保留两份独立快照,分别存储在不同的可用区。

高主频ECS服务器迁移的两种主流方案对比

针对高主频实例,业界普遍采用两种迁移路径:基于镜像的离线迁移和基于实时同步的热迁移,选择哪种方案,取决于业务对停机时间的容忍度。

基于镜像的离线迁移(推荐用于大多数场景)

这是最稳妥、成本最低且成功率最高的方案,虽然需要短暂停机,但操作逻辑清晰,风险可控。

操作步骤详解

  1. 创建自定义镜像:在源实例停止运行后,创建自定义镜像,这一步会将系统盘和数据盘的状态打包成一个镜像文件。
  2. 跨地域复制(如需):如果目标服务器位于不同地域,需使用镜像复制功能,将镜像复制到目标地域。
  3. 创建新实例:在目标地域,使用复制后的自定义镜像创建新的高主频ECS实例。
  4. 配置网络与安全组:将新实例加入原有的VPC和交换机,配置相同的安全组规则,确保网络连通性。
  5. 切换DNS解析:在确认新实例运行正常后,将域名解析指向新实例的公网IP。

基于实时同步的热迁移(适用于高可用要求场景)

如果业务不允许任何停机,可以考虑使用云厂商提供的“服务器迁移中心”或第三方工具进行实时数据同步。

技术实现逻辑

  • 增量同步:通过Agent在源实例上部署迁移工具,实时将数据块同步到目标实例。
  • 断点续传

    高主频ecs服务器怎么迁移?ecs服务器迁移数据丢失怎么办

    :在网络波动或中断时,支持从断点处继续同步,避免重复传输大量数据。

  • 最终切换:在业务低峰期,暂停源实例写入,进行最后一次增量同步,然后快速切换流量至目标实例。

高主频ECS服务器迁移后的验证与优化

迁移完成并非终点,验证和优化才是确保业务稳定运行的关键,高主频实例的性能表现需要精细调优,才能发挥其最大价值。

性能基准测试

使用专业的基准测试工具(如UnixBench、Sysbench)对新实例进行压力测试,对比迁移前后的性能数据。

  • CPU利用率监控:观察在高负载下,CPU是否出现瓶颈,主频是否稳定在标称值。
  • 网络吞吐量测试:验证网络带宽是否达到预期,特别是对于高并发场景,网络延迟是关键指标。
  • 磁盘I/O性能:检查读写速度是否满足业务需求,必要时调整磁盘队列深度或I/O调度算法。

应用配置适配

不同实例的硬件参数可能略有差异,应用配置可能需要微调。

  • 线程数调整:根据新实例的CPU核心数,调整应用服务器的线程池大小,避免资源浪费或竞争。
  • 内存分配优化:检查内存分配是否合理,避免OOM(内存溢出)错误。
  • 日志路径检查:确认应用日志路径是否正确,避免因路径变更导致日志无法写入。

高主频ECS服务器迁移常见误区与避坑指南

在实际操作中,许多用户容易陷入一些常见误区,导致迁移失败或性能下降。

忽视跨可用区延迟

如果源实例和目标实例位于不同可用区,网络延迟可能会增加,对于高主频实例,通常要求低延迟,因此建议将目标实例部署在与源实例相同的可用区,或至少是同一地域内的邻近可用区。

忽略安全组规则

迁移后,新实例的安全组规则可能与源实例不同,导致业务访问失败,务必在迁移前导出源实例的安全组规则,并在创建新实例时精确复制。

高主频ecs服务器怎么迁移?ecs服务器迁移数据丢失怎么办

未进行灰度测试

直接切换全部流量风险极高,建议先通过内网IP或临时域名进行小范围灰度测试,验证业务功能正常后,再逐步切换公网流量。

高主频ECS服务器迁移价格与成本考量

迁移成本不仅包括数据流量费用,还包括停机期间的业务损失。

数据流量费用

跨地域迁移会产生数据出网流量费用,据行业共识认为,合理规划迁移窗口,利用夜间低峰期进行大规模数据传输,可以有效降低网络拥塞风险,但流量费用本身通常由云厂商按量计费,需提前预算。

停机成本评估

对于高主频实例,停机一分钟可能意味着数千甚至数万元的收入损失,选择在线热迁移方案虽然初期投入较高,但从长期业务连续性来看,往往更具性价比。

高主频ECS服务器迁移相关问题解答

高主频ECS服务器迁移需要停机多久?

基于镜像的离线迁移通常需要停机10-30分钟,主要用于创建快照、复制镜像和启动新实例,在线热迁移可以将停机时间压缩至秒级,但需要复杂的配置和测试,多数情况下,业务方会根据停机时间容忍度选择相应方案。

迁移后CPU主频会下降吗?

如果目标实例规格与源实例完全一致,且在同一可用区内,主频通常不会下降,但如果跨代际迁移或目标实例负载较高,可能出现主频波动,建议迁移后进行基准测试,确保性能达标。

高主频ECS服务器迁移失败如何回滚?

如果迁移后新实例出现严重问题,可立即将DNS解析切回源实例IP,由于源实例在迁移期间保持只读或停止状态,数据未发生实质性变更,因此可以安全回滚,关键在于迁移前必须保留完整的源实例快照,以便在极端情况下恢复数据。

文章来源网络,作者:管理,如若转载,请注明出处:https://shuyeidc.com/wp/481606.html<

(0)
管理的头像管理
上一篇2026-06-18 07:10
下一篇 2025-11-15 14:51

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注